353: An AI-Powered Holiday Season Learn how to make this an AI-Powered Holiday Season! If the holidays feel overwhelming, especially for moms carrying the mental load, AI can help you offload decisions, plan your days, generate gift ideas, create activities, and more. 1. Use AI to Create a Manageable Holiday Schedule Tools like ChatGPT and Gemini can turn a long, overwhelming to-do list into a structured plan. You can: Use voice mode to quickly offload everything you need to do Include specific tasks like preparing guest rooms, decorating, errands, cleaning, or cooking Ask AI to assign age-appropriate chores to kids Request a day-by-day schedule or detailed breakdown of today’s tasks 2. Stress-Free Gift Shopping with AI AI can help generate highly personalized, budget-conscious ideas. Tips: Provide detailed information: age, hobbies, interests, personality, budget Ask for alternatives to expensive gifts Request price comparisons; Perplexity is especially good for this Use AI to help brainstorm DIY gift options For personalized items, Canva’s AI tools can help quickly create bookmarks, calendars, cards, or certificates. You can also add an AI-generated poem, story, or even a custom song using SUNO. 3. AI for Holiday Meal Planning and Leftovers AI can plan holiday meals, weekly menus, grocery lists, and leftover transformations. You can request: Meal plans with specific time limits Menus without certain allergens or ingredients A holiday dinner with detailed restrictions A shopping list pulled from your own uploaded recipes After large holiday meals, list your leftover ingredients and ask AI for several creative recipes. Kids can vote on their favorite. 4. Travel Planning with AI AI can streamline travel planning during the holidays: Suggest scenic detours Recommend kid-friendly stops Create packing lists based on your destination’s weather For long drives, you can request car-friendly games tailored to your children’s ages. Travel Bingo Ask AI to generate 30–40 things you might see along your route. Have it create customized 5×5 bingo cards. Print and enjoy. 5.
